Poster design for the exhibition Thomas Mann’s—The Magic Mountain. Feverdream and Altitude rush shown at the Buddenbrookhaus hosted in the St. Annen Museum in Lübeck from 09.13.24 until 03.02.2025. The poster reflects the atmosphere of the seven exhibitions rooms the visitor has to pass and creates a link to the different visual filters used in the exhibition.

Thomas Mann’s—The Magic Mountain. Feverdream and Altitude rush talks about the central topics and conflicts in the novel: death and life, desire and love, war and peace. The exhibition connects these timeless themes with our present day. The novel, which is set on the eve of the First World War, is as current as ever even a hundred years after its publication: Nationalism, a lack of scientific knowledge, ignorance and hate speech are relevant across all temporal breaks and epochal changes.
